Recap: Red Rock Central Falcons vs. Murray County Central Rebels        
        
		
            
 If the Red Rock Central Falcons were riding high  off their  68-46 takedown of the Adrian/Ellsworth Dragons last Tuesday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. Red Rock Central took a  64-51 hit to the loss column at the hands of Murray County Central on Friday. Red Rock Central has not had much luck with Murray County Central recently, as the team's come up short the last eight times they've met.
 When it comes to explaining why Red Rock Central lost, one person who can't be blamed is  Isaac Simonson. Despite the final result, he  dropped  a double-double on 35 points and 11  rebounds. As a matter of fact, that's the most points  Simonson has scored all season. The team also got some help courtesy of  Ashton Holmen, who  scored six points along with eight  assists and five  rebounds.
 Red Rock Central's defeat dropped their record down to 12-16. As for Murray County Central, their victory was  their fifth straight at home, which  pushed their record up to 15-12.
 Red Rock Central will head out on the road to  take on  Westbrook-Walnut Grove at 7:30  p.m.  on Monday. Hopefully Red Rock Central focused on turnovers this week  since the team gave up 11 on Friday. As for Murray County Central, they will look to defend their home court  on Monday against Southwest Minnesota Christian at 7:30  p.m.
